Antagonism of enterotoxigenic Escherichia coli heat-labile toxin by quinacrine in rats
Article | IMSEAR | ID: sea-127034
ABSTRACT
Escherichia coli strain W 165-1/82 which produce heat-labile toxin (LT) was used in preparation of enterotoxin. Ligated intestinal rat model using wistar rats were used to obtain the maximum secretory response after challenging with the toxin. It was found that quinacrine inhibited the secretory response and also reduced the cyclic adenosine monophosphate (cAMP) level in the intestinal fluids. The maximum secretory response was obtained with 125 ug of crude LT toxin in 61-80 grams of rats. It was also noted that 500 ug of quinacrine produced a maximum inhibition in rats.
